A cook is storing bags of onions and boxes of canned tomatoes in dry storage. Which practice is correct?

a.Leave the boxes near a leaking pipe if covered
b.Keep the room at 80°F to save on cooling
c.Stack the boxes directly against the outside wall on the floor
d.Store items on shelving at least 6 inches off the floor, away from walls, in a clean, dry, well-ventilated room at 50°F to 70°F

Giải thích

Dry goods should be stored on cleanable shelving at least 6 inches off the floor, away from walls, in a clean, dry, well-ventilated room kept between 50°F and 70°F. Stacking on the floor against a wall blocks cleaning and invites pests, 80°F accelerates spoilage and infestation, and storing near a leaking pipe risks contamination even if boxes are covered.

Trích dẫn luật: FDA Food Code §3-305.11
